A 3-year targeted survey analysed 714 samples of plant-based ice cream alternatives for the presence of the pathogens Salmonella and Listeria monocytogenes. All samples were also tested for total coliforms and Aerobic Colony Count. Overall, the survey results indicate that plant-based ice cream alternatives sold in Canada are generally safe for consumption.
